Yes, my 12TB G-Raid has been crashing quite frequently and yesterday the “G” on the front panel illuminated red rather than the usual white. I have now downloaded the G-RAID with Thunderbolt 3 configurator and that informed me that one of the 2 drives was corrupted and gave me the option of rebuilding that drive using the contents of the other drive. That now appears to be proceeding OK. However I won’t know if the rebuild has been successful until later tonight. I’ll get back in touch then if the problem persists.
